Finding the love of your life is rare and special, but what happens after you’ve both grown old and one has to live without the other due to death?

Well, thankfully, this elderly couple from Petaling Jaya didn’t have to experience that.

According to a report by Sin Chew Daily, a 102-year-old man passed away at 6am on June 11 (Sunday) in his home.

Upon hearing the news, his 94-year-old wife cried tears of  followed him to the afterlife merely hours later, at around 6pm while admitted at a hospital due to health issues.

Despite being apart during their last hours on earth, they were reunited soon enough.

The couple was said to be in love and happily married for about 80 years. They had 5 sons and a daughter together which eventually grew into a 4th generation with over 50 descendants.

 

The family held a ‘happy funeral’ on the morning of June 14 (Wednesday) for the departed love birds, traditionally to symbolise and celebrate the loving and fulfilling life they lived together.

Everyone wore red shirts as they accompanied the deceased to their final resting place at the Bukit Gasing Memorial Park.

 

Considering how closely knit the family is, it’s certain that the elderly couple’s love will live on among them.
